Subject: Sutent w. Thyroid side effects (TSH)
Date: 12/19/2007

Hey Everyone,

My mom is one her 2 nd cycle of 37.5 but has taken 9 cycles of 50 mg w/ the tradition of 28 days on and 14 days off.  All her tissue tumors are gone but her PET scan still shows activity on her neck and third right rib. Other wise still stable.

However, one of the side of effects was being hypoththyroidism. Her TSH is above 100 and will be soon seeing an endocronologist. This had led to fatigue, cholesterol high, easily feels cold, and high cholesterol.

Is anyone else hypothyroidism? If yes what were your treatments or experience?

-Cathy 

Subject: RE: Sutent w. Thyroid side effects (TSH)
Date: 12/21/2007
Hi my name is Robbie, age 52, female.  I too was on 50mg for two full cycles.  Before the end of my second cycle the Dr said my TSH was 118He prescribed Synthroi 50mcg.  Ten days after taking it my hair started to thin all over.  By the tenth day my hair was 70% thinner.  This shedding went on for several weeks.  It has since leveled off.  I am stll not sure what happenned to my hair.  I think the Synthroid must have jumpstarted my hair growth pushing out old hair.   I have finished three complete cycles of Sutent 37.5.  TSH levels will go up and down on Sutent and from what I have read almost 60% will become hypothyroid.  my TSH goes up and down based on the Sutent.   I have had my TSH checked during my off cycles and it has been normal.  I hope this helps.
